Testicular cancer (TC) is the most common cancer in males aged 20–40 years, with a worldwide incidence of 7.5 per 100,000, but the rates vary considerably between countries and ethnic groups and there is evidence also for an increasing incidence in last decades. About 95% of all TCs are represented by testicular germ cell tumors (TGCTs), which include seminoma and non-seminoma histological type...

The direction of gonadal development is established through the predominance of one of two sex-determining pathways in bipotential gonads. When Sry is expressed, the male pathway prevails and a series of prominent changes in morphology and function of the gonad lead to testis differentiation. Spermatogenesis is a highly coordinated physiological process that requires the correct expression and functions of thousands of developmentally regulated genes. The regulation of spermatogenesis is not well defined, since majority of the related genes have neither been identified nor fully characterized. Testis of Hemidactylus flaviviridis, commonly known as Indian wall lizard, displays a lack of cellular and metabolic activity in regressed phase of testis during non-breeding season of the year. Retracted Sertoli cells (Sc), fibroid myoid cells and pre-meiotic resting spermatogonia are observed in such testis. Males and females exhibit highly dimorphic phenotypes, particularly in their gonads, which is believed to be driven largely by differential gene expression. Typically, the protein sequences of genes upregulated in males, or male-biased genes, evolve rapidly as compared to female-biased and unbiased genes. Protamine mRNA was isolated in a very pure form from trout testis and used as a template for the synthesis of a complementary DNA of high specific activity. The cDNA represented a full copy of the mRNA template and was used in hybridization reactions with purified trout DNA to determine the number of genes for protamines in trout testis.
